thanks for the suggestions, I mainly use slalom fins now a days and was wondering what is the point of sweepback on the fin? Less frontal surface area to reduce drag?
No I think its just about getting amenable behaviour. It will tend to steer more downwind when it flexes under load. If it sweeps forward it would tend to steer upwind more when loaded. You can imagine what that would be like with the pressure going on and off in bumpy water. I doubt that you could stop it from spinning out.
